Extends certain accommodations for businesses participating in State economic development programs.
S 3303 extends a temporary accommodation for businesses participating in New Jersey's economic development programs, allowing them to reduce the required percentage of full-time employees' time spent at business facilities. The bill extends the existing waiver beyond March 31, 2024, requiring businesses to have employees spend at least 40% of their time at facilities (up from 10%) and pay 20% of their tax credits to municipal affordable housing trust funds (up from 5%). This applies to businesses in programs like the Business Employment Incentive Program and Grow New Jersey Assistance Program. The bill also includes provisions for carrying forward tax credits for up to 20 years and transferring tax credits.
